Kangava community demands justice for 2019 oil spill

Solomon Islands

The customary landowners of Kangava Bay in the Solomon Islands have filed a claim with the Solomon Islands High Court for damages caused by a 2019 oil spill, the worst of its kind in the nation. The claim was filed jointly with the Solomon Islands Government on 31 January 2025.

Barrister at Doughty Street Chambers in London, Harj Narulla, said: “This case is one of the worst environmental disasters in Pacific history.”
